OUR TOWN COOKS!

By DONNA NICKEL

At Cheese-n-Crackers Deli on W. Maple Street, the dessert of choice is chocolate chip cookies. “They're right up there with the peanut butter bars as top sellers,” said owner Peg Callihan who came up with the recipe approximately 25 years ago. “I think the reason people like them is because they're soft.” While there's no secret ingredient, Peg said following the directions is crucial. “The beating time is very important.”

CHEESE-N-CRACKER DELI C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ES

1 lb margarine
1 1/2 cups granulated sugar
1 1/2 cups brown sugar
1 Tbsp Vanilla
4 eggs
2 tsp baking soda
1 tsp salt
4 cups flour
2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ips

Cream together margarine and sugars until light and f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, mixing after each.
Add vanilla and beat 5 minutes at high speed. Sift together flour, baking soda and salt. Add gradually to creamed mixture. Mix well. Fold in chocolate chips.

Bake cookies in preheated 350 degree oven on parchment lined pans 12-15 min or until lightly browned.
